Unique riverfront property offers versatility, tranquil location, and a blank canvas for your lifestyle needs. A 2,500 sq. ft. 3 bedroom, 2 1/4 bath modular Ranch boasts spectacular elevated views along 1,000+/- feet of the Penobscot River-there's even historical remnants of a steamboat wharf and the 200+ year old Worcester Granite quarry. The current owner had been passively marketing existing granite slabs to landscapers. The 2004 home offers a spacious eat-in kitchen, boasting handsome granite countertops, farm sink, 5 burner gas cookstove/oven, microwave, Bosch dishwasher, and a matched pair of commercial sized refrigerator/freezer. Huge LR w/heat pump will handle a large crowd and the biggest flat screen TV you could find! A laundry hook up and full bath are just off the dining area with 3 sunny spacious bedrooms and a full bath w/a step-in tub and shower located further down the hall. Elegant hardwood floors are throughout most of the home. Need space for storage or a business? The 4,300 +/- Sq. Ft. warehouse/shop built in 1992 offers garage space, storage, freezer room, office and spacious finished room on the 2nd floor. Owner used this building for a slaughterhouse, seafood processing facility, and a cowhide bait complex. The 16x76 six bay building was used for horse stalls-but could be converted into storage for equipment. There is also a 40x35 barn for hay storage, campers, or big equipment. The Southerly boundary is conservation land.

Step into this spacious custom-built home to experience year-round living on the east side of Sand Pond, a desirable 135-acre, mile long waterbody with its clear deep water and nesting loons. There is no public access or road adjoining this quiet lake, and only the occasional motorized craft. When you are not relaxing on the dock, adventure awaits at the areas 3 ski mountains, several golf courses and many local nature preserves which offer hiking, snow shoeing and cross-country skiing. Just minutes from downtown Norway's vibrant historic district with its local brewery, quaint restaurants, coffee and antique shops, and hospital, the home is a quick hour drive to Portland, or under three to Boston. With over 4100 square feet of inviting living space, this 3 BR+/4 BA home offers a first floor primary suite, second floor guest bedrooms and a striking vaulted bonus room, a spacious daylight artist's studio in the basement, and a 2 car garage. There is a spacious daylight artist's studio in the basement, also suitable for a kids play area, fitness room or other creative activities. With a screened farmer's porch on the front of the house and large deck and year round sunroom on the lake side, this home offers many places to relax and entertain. The 1.6 acre lot features 150' of waterfront. Dive from the floating dock into over 10 feet of clean water. Built in 1999 with many upgrades such as shaker cabinets, quartz countertops, and an indoor sauna, the home includes several unique features such as bathroom countertops made from local schoolhouse slate chalkboards and a pottery mural designed by Bonnema pottery in Bethel. Well maintained home includes new roof and appliances (including a gas range), as well as a Generac whole house generator. This well loved waterfront home is waiting for its next owners of nature lovers. More than a beautiful home or vacation retreat, it is a lifestyle in a wonderful community.
